Available for Opportunities

Hello, I'm Daniel Elias

Full-Stack Software Engineer specializing in scalable web, mobile, and AI-powered solutions. Passionate about building products that deliver exceptional user experiences and measurable business impact.

Daniel Elias

Technical Expertise

Comprehensive skill set across modern development technologies and methodologies

Frontend Development

Building responsive, accessible web applications with modern frameworks and best practices. Focus on performance optimization and intuitive user interfaces.

HTML5 CSS3 JavaScript

Backend Engineering

Designing and implementing robust server-side architectures with RESTful APIs, microservices, and scalable database solutions.

Java Spring Boot REST API PostgreSQL

Mobile Development

Creating native and cross-platform mobile applications with seamless performance across Android and iOS devices.

Android Flutter Dart

Data Structures & Algorithms

Strong foundation in computer science fundamentals with expertise in algorithmic problem-solving and optimization techniques.

C++ Algorithms Problem Solving

AI & Machine Learning

Integrating AI capabilities into applications through model fine-tuning, API integration, and intelligent feature development.

Model Fine-tuning NLP AI Integration

Professional Experience

Hands-on experience through personal projects, coding challenges, and practical software development tasks focused on full-stack and AI solutions

Full-Stack Development Projects

Personal & Academic Projects
2024 - Present
Developed web and mobile applications, integrating modern technologies and AI-driven features
  • Built responsive web apps using HTML, CSS, JavaScript, and React for interactive user experiences
  • Implemented backend APIs with Java Spring Boot, handling database interactions efficiently
  • Explored AI integrations such as recommendation systems and predictive models in personal projects
  • Used Git and GitHub for version control and collaborative development

Software Engineering Challenges

Competitions & Learning Platforms
2023 - Present
Solved coding problems, optimized algorithms, and built practical solutions
  • Participated in online coding challenges on platforms like LeetCode, HackerRank, and Sololearn
  • Applied algorithmic and data structure knowledge to solve real-world problems efficiently
  • Collaborated on small group projects simulating professional software development workflows
  • Documented and deployed projects for portfolio showcase using GitHub Pages

Education Background

Academic foundation and continuous learning journey in computer science and engineering

Bachelor of Science in Software Engineering
University Of Dodoma
2024 - to date

Focused on software engineering, algorithms, and emerging technologies. Currently pursuing a degree in Software Engineering with a passion for building scalable systems and exploring AI-driven solutions.

Advanced Level Education
Iyunga Technical School
2022 - 2024

Excelled in Physics, Mathematics, and Computer studies, building a strong analytical foundation for a career in software engineering. Actively participated in computer clubs and regional coding competitions.

Certifications

Professional certifications demonstrating expertise and commitment to continuous learning

Python developer

Sololearn
Issued 23 October, 2024
View Certificate

AWS Certified Developer - Associate

Amazon Web Services
still learning

Oracle Certified Java Programmer

Oracle
still learning

Languages

Proficiency in spoken and written languages to facilitate global collaboration

English
Fluent (Professional Working Proficiency)
Swahili
Native Speaker

Featured Projects

Recent work showcasing technical expertise and innovative problem-solving

E-Commerce Platform

Full-featured e-commerce solution with Spring Boot backend, responsive web interface, and Flutter mobile app. Includes secure payment processing and real-time inventory management.

Spring Boot Flutter MySQL REST API

AI Assistant Application

Intelligent chatbot leveraging fine-tuned language models with natural language understanding capabilities across web and mobile platforms.

AI/ML Python Android NLP

Analytics Dashboard

Real-time data visualization platform with interactive charts, custom reporting, and comprehensive business intelligence features.

JavaScript Spring Boot D3.js REST API

Cross-Platform Mobile App

Feature-rich mobile application delivering consistent user experience across iOS and Android with offline-first architecture.

Flutter Dart Firebase UI/UX

Authentication System

Enterprise-grade authentication solution implementing JWT tokens, OAuth 2.0, role-based access control, and security best practices.

Spring Security JWT OAuth API

Algorithm Visualizer

Educational platform for visualizing sorting and searching algorithms with step-by-step execution and performance analysis.

C++ Algorithms JavaScript Visualization

Let's Connect

Open to discussing new opportunities, collaborations, and innovative projects

Let's Start a Conversation

Reach out to discuss your project or explore potential collaborations

Connect on WhatsApp

Response time: Usually within a few hours